A town in upstate New York voted to remove the LGBT “Pride” flag earlier this month, sparking outraged protests and an act of vandalism.

For the first time in the town’s history, Webster Town Supervisor Alex Scialdone on June 1 raised the gay flag at Town Hall and issued a “Pride Month” proclamation. After public comment from residents, Republicans elected to the town board voted to effectively remove the “Pride” flag by adopting a policy that limits flags on town property to the U.S. and New York state flags. By June 5, the “Pride” flag was removed.

At the removal, protesters gathered outside Town Hall, and some LGBT activists screamed and yelled about the flag removal, which was captured on video taken by town supervisor candidate Kevin Lockhart. One woman wearing a rainbow sweater claimed she “nearly died five times in the last month,” supposedly over LGBT opposition. Another said “children will kill themselves for this.”

“We see, we hear, we will not live in fear,” was also chanted by protesters.

Days later, the American flag at Town Hall was moved to the bottom of the flagpole, and an LGBT flag was flown far above it. According to U.S. Flag Code, no other flag should be flown above the American flag when displayed together.

“I remain steadfast in my advocacy for the LGBT community; however, I do not condone any flag being placed above the American flag,” Scialdone said in a statement. “When Town personnel became aware of the unauthorized lowering of the American flag on Town Hall property, immediate action was taken to raise it back into place.”

It’s unclear if anyone has been held accountable for the unauthorized tampering. The Webster Police Department confirmed to The Daily Wire that an investigation into the matter was opened, but was recently closed. No other details were provided.

Currently, the American flag is the only flag flying at Town Hall, and padlocks have been added to the flagpole.
